86 Person improperly served as partner
(1) In a proceeding against a partnership started by claim, a person who is
served as a partner may file a conditional notice of intention to defend
stating—
(a) the person files the notice because the person was served as a
partner; and
(b) the person denies being a partner at a material time or
being liable as a partner.
(2) On application, the court may—
(a) set aside
the service of an originating process on the person on the ground that the
person is not a partner or is not liable as a partner; or
(b) set aside a
conditional notice of intention to defend on the ground that the person is a
partner or is liable as a partner.
(3) The court may give directions about
how to decide the liability of the person or the liability of the partners.
